CHAMPIONS: Vipers SC lifts Uganda Premier League title

Moses Abeka by Moses Abeka
May 25, 2018
in Sports
Reading Time: 1 min read
Share on FacebookShare on Twitter

The three-year wait for a league title is over.  Vipers SC is the 2017/18 the Uganda Premier League champions! Vipers went into the final game of the season two points above KCCA FC and needed a win to finish the job- and they did just that.

It took Vipers strong determination to come from behind after UPDF’s Janjali found the back of the net in the 24th minute. However, after several frantic misses, Yayo’s eqauliser in the extra time of the first half calmed down nerves before the break.

UPDF defender Othieno Deo had a day to forget as his blunders gave Vipers a day they will never forget. In the 65th minute, he handled the ball in the box gifting Erisa Ssekisambu the golden opportunity as the spot kick found the back of the net. Vipers sealed the game in 84th minute with Dan Sserunkuma capitalising on Othieno’s failure to clear the ball. Wangi Pius  later came in substitute for Dan and added the fourth goal in the extra time after normal time  as icing on the cake for Vipers’ hard fought title run. Vipers took the day 4 -1.

In the other game, KCCA’s title hopes came crushing as they shared spoils in a 2-2 thriller.
